先说说事件回放某天客户端要求说tcp包要小点,这样他开的buffer就小点那我就找到acceptor.getSessionConfig().setSendBufferSize(int);这个方法设置发送byte buffer的大小,但我把他设置成1,让他每个包都即时发送mina的setSendBufferSize方法是一个接口,他会调用java.net.Socket.setSendBuffer
转载
2024-08-04 14:04:22
42阅读
目录 目录:(一)以文本形式存取1.说明:2.语法解释:3.实例(以.csv文件为例)4.效果展示(二)以任意的形式存取1.说明:2.语法解释:3.实例(以.bat二进制文件为例)4.效果展示(三)以np自定义的形式存取1.说明:2.语法解释:3.实例:4.实例展示 目录:目录:1.以文本形式存取2.以任意的形式存取3.以np自定义的形式存取(一)以文本形式存取1.说明:(1)适用范围:存储
转载
2024-03-16 09:54:02
69阅读
崩溃报告有两种:1.有报告内容:低内存报告2.无报告内容:崩溃报告头部信息(Header)每份崩溃报告的开头都带有一个头部信息。//报告的唯一标识,每个崩溃日志都有它独一无二的编号
Incident Identifier: CDB1BD45-7742-4A51-A6DE-79DFD906CE68
//每台设备的匿名标识
CrashReporter Key: e1029dc543d8c78447
转载
2024-07-10 09:43:16
55阅读
# Java中File对象的管理与释放
在Java编程中,`File`类是用于表示文件和目录的一个重要类。创建`File`对象的操作相对简单,例如使用`new File("路径")`,但对于初学者而言,如何有效地管理和释放`File`对象却常常带来困惑。本文将深入探讨这一主题,并提供实用的代码示例,帮助读者解决实际问题。
## 1. 理解Java中的File对象
在Java中,`File`对
原创
2024-10-05 06:48:23
177阅读
# 如何释放MySQL锁表
在使用MySQL数据库时,有时候会出现锁表的情况,当表被锁住时其他用户无法对表进行操作,这时就需要及时释放锁定的表。本文将介绍在MySQL中如何释放锁表。
## 锁表的释放方法
### 1. 查看锁表情况
在释放锁表之前,首先需要查看表的锁定情况。可以通过以下命令查看表的锁定状态:
```sql
SHOW OPEN TABLES WHERE In_use >
原创
2024-03-14 05:50:36
1608阅读
简介Web 开发中经常会遇到性能的问题,尤其是 Web 2.0 的应用。CSS 代码是控制页面显示样式与效果的最直接“工具”,但是在性能调优时他们通常被 Web 开发工程师所忽略,而事实上不规范的 CSS 会对页面渲染的效率有严重影响,尤其是对于结构复杂的 Web 2.0 页面,这种影响更是不可磨灭。所以,写出规范的、高性能的 CSS 代码会极大的提高应用程序的效率。本文主要来探讨一下如何优化,以
转载
2024-06-26 09:16:38
246阅读
opencv易错点记录1. 判断条件不应使用CV_ASSERT(),而使用CV_Assert(). 2. 用下面这个自适应阈值必须进行数据的转换,不能直接传入数据!不然程序一直崩溃,找了很久才发现。 最后一个参数给个0就可以了,倒数第二个参数为大于1的数。 倒数第二个参数一定为基数,当为偶数的时候一直奔溃!!!
设计好一个漂亮的 REST + JSON API 之后,如何对你的 API 进行保护?在 Stormpath,我们花了 18 个月来寻找最佳实践,将其一一实践于 Stormpath API 中并分析其效果。本文将阐述如何保护 REST API。
选择合适的安全协议行业标准认证协议有助于减少就保护你的 API 所做的相关投入。也可以使用自定义安全协议,但仅
【导读】图像预处理的一个重要操作就是resize,把不同大小的图像缩放到同一尺寸,但目前用到的resize技术仍然是老旧的,无法根据数据变换。Google Research提出一个可学习的resizer,只需在预处理部分略作修改,即可提升CV模型性能!神经网络要求输入的数据的大小在每个mini-batch中是统一的,所以在做视觉任务的时候,一个重要的预处理步骤就是image resize,把它们调
文章目录✅ 1. 准备工作☑️ 1.1 streamlit脚本准备☑️ 1.2 Dockerfile准备▶️ 1.2.1模板▶️ 1.2.2 我个人的✅ 2. pip安装私有包✅ 3. docker build☑️ 3.1 构建镜像☑️ 3.2 运行容器☑️ 3.3 删除容器和镜像☑️ 3.4 后台运行容器/后台调回前面 ✅ 1. 准备工作☑️ 1.1 streamlit脚本准备把你的strea
思维导图:点击查看思维导图.1.对象创建的流程
1.类加载检查 当JVM执行一条new指令时,最开始会去检查这个指令的参数是否能在常量池中定位到一个类的符号引用,并且检查这个符号引用代表的类是否已经被加载、验证、解析、初始化。如果没有,执行响应的类加载过程。 &nbs
# MySQL表清理后释放存储空间的方案
在数据管理中,清理无用数据是保持数据库性能的重要步骤。MySQL提供了多种方式来清理表数据,但许多人在清理数据后并未能有效地释放存储空间。本文将探讨如何在MySQL中有效释放存储空间,并提供一套完整的解决方案,包括代码示例、ER图和饼状图。
## 一、背景
随着时间的推移,数据库中的数据可能会不断增加,导致性能下降和存储空间不足。因此,定期进行表清理
原创
2024-08-07 03:36:35
42阅读
## Python 图像resize后不显示
在使用Python处理图像时,我们经常会遇到需要调整图像尺寸的情况。然而,有时候我们发现即使成功调整了图像尺寸,但在显示时却遇到了问题,图像并不能正确地显示出来。本文将介绍这个问题的原因,并给出解决方法。
### 问题描述
当我们使用Python中的PIL库或者OpenCV库调整图像尺寸后,有时会发现调整后的图像不能正常显示。例如,我们可以使用P
原创
2024-01-03 07:50:51
199阅读
# Python图像resize后保存
## 引言
在Python中,我们可以使用第三方库PIL(Python Imaging Library)来处理图像。其中一个常见的需求是调整图像的大小(resize)并保存为新的图像文件。本文将向刚入行的小白开发者介绍如何使用Python实现这个功能。
## 整体流程
我们可以将整个流程分为以下步骤,并用表格展示:
| 步骤 | 描述 |
| --
原创
2023-12-12 03:40:30
177阅读
作者: Sam (甄峰)
前面主要介绍的是:V4L2 的一些设置接口,如亮度,饱和度,曝光时间,帧数,增益,白平衡等。今天看看V4L2 得到数据的几个关键ioctl,Buffer的申请和数据的抓取。
1. 初始化 Memory Mapping 或 User Pointer I/O.
int ioctl(int fd, int requestbuf,
转载
2024-05-08 20:02:38
40阅读
Oracle数据库有三种常用的备份方法,分别是导出/导入(EXP/IMP)或者使用数据泵方法(impdp/expdp)、热备份和冷备份。导出/导入备份是一种逻辑备份,相对于导出/导入来说,热备份、冷备份是一种物理备份 。 一、exp 我们知道采用direct path可以提高导出速度。所以,在使用exp时,就可以采用直接路径模式。 这种模式有2个相关的参数:DIRECT和RECORDLENG
首先,从二者的名字上可以看出区别:reserve(): serve 是“保留”的词根,所以是用来预留容量的,并不会改变容器的有效元素个数。即用reserve()开辟空间时,仅改变capacity大小,与size无关。resize(): size 是“大小”的意思,它主要用来调整容器有效元素的个数,有时候也会造成容量的改变。因此用resize()开辟空间时,会对增加的空间全部进行初始化,使得有效元素
转载
2024-04-09 10:27:58
62阅读
(一)锁当数据库有并发事务的时候,可能会产生数据不一致,这时候需要一些机制来保证访问次序,锁机制就是这样的一个机制。1)隔离级别与锁的关系在ReadUncommitted级别下,读取数据不需要加共享锁,这样就不会和被修改的数据上的排他锁冲突。在ReadCommitted级别下,读操作需要加共享锁,但是在语句执行完之后释放共享锁。在RepeatableRead级别下,读操作需要加共享锁,但是在事务提
转载
2023-09-25 17:20:08
217阅读
# 项目方案:MySQL 数据清空后怎么释放空间
## 1. 问题背景
在使用 MySQL 数据库时,经常会遇到删除大量数据后,数据库占用的磁盘空间并没有释放的情况。这是因为 MySQL 在删除数据时,并不会立即释放磁盘空间,而是将空间标记为可复用。如果频繁进行大量数据的删除操作,数据库的磁盘空间可能会不断增加,影响系统性能和可用空间。
## 2. 解决方案
为了解决这个问题,我们可以通过以下
原创
2024-03-22 04:15:50
253阅读
在去年毕马威国际(KPMG International)调查的2,190名全球高级管理人员中,只有35%的人表示他们对组织使用数据和分析的方式有很高的信任度。大约三分之二的人对他们的数据和分析持保留或不信任的态度。其中,62%的高管表示主要责任在于组织内的技术部门。分析能指导企业决策,但前提是这种数据分析是基于完整高质量的数据。很多情况下,数据分析项目的失败并非完全归咎于BI平台本身,前期的数据准
转载
2024-09-28 10:48:15
65阅读